Southampton is one of the UK's busiest port cities — and that comes at a cost to its air. Between heavy road traffic across the city centre, diesel emissions from freight vehicles serving the docks, and the significant exhaust output of cruise ships and cargo vessels, Southampton's built environment is exposed to an unusually high concentration of airborne pollutants.
Much of that pollution doesn't stay outside. It infiltrates offices, schools, retail units, and commercial premises throughout the city, mixing with indoor-generated contaminants like VOCs, mould spores, and elevated CO₂ to create an indoor air quality (IAQ) problem that most building owners and managers aren't even aware they have.

What's involved in Indoor Air Quality Testing?
The air quality testing service we offer is a wide range of individual tests for different types of pollutants. Once you book a service with us, the process will flow in three simple steps:
- Initial Consultation: we discuss the building specifications, the current air quality concerns, and what can be done to improve the air quality within the building.
- Air Testing: depending on the types of pollutants tested, we may use passive sampling, active sampling, surface sampling, or indoor air quality monitors to learn more about your environment.
- Detailed Reporting: we hand over a thorough site analysis report to help inform your air quality improvements with our expert recommendations.
